Job Responsibilities
- Ensures all orders have been placed on time
- Communicate with staff re: order changes, shortages, substitutions, due dates, deadlines, etc.
- Communicates with vendors regarding order accuracy and product quality
- Writes inventory reports and submits to the Director of Logistics and Transportation for review
- Provides customer service and solutions to problems for site managers and Field Coordinators
- Develop systems, procedures, and records for quality control
- Ensures production records are completed daily to forecast projections
- Collaborates with Procurement & Contracts Manager and FNS management staff for goods and services specifications document and resolve issues including orders, receipts, invoices; Nutrition Manager regarding product availability for menu planning.
- Ensure supply, ingredients, and materials available to produce daily orders, including packaging, and food quality;
- Troubleshoots internal order management systems
- Performs audits on inventory counts in Central Warehouse and school sites to ensure accuracy
- Oversee the orders, receipts, invoices, bills, credits, etc. for accuracy and compliance with contracts. Take action in the case of discrepancies.
- Documents discrepancies
- Performs other duties as assigned.
